With a population of 322, 235 total housing units (homes and apartments), and a median house value of $207,706, house prices in Ruffin are solidly below the national average.
Single-family detached homes are the single most common housing type in Ruffin, accounting for 57.95% of the town's housing units. Other types of housing that are prevalent in Ruffin include mobile homes or trailers ( 31.06%), large apartment complexes or high rise apartments ( 10.98%).
Owner-occupied, three and four bedroom dwellings, primarily in single-family detached homes are the most prevalent type of housing you will see in Ruffin. Owner-occupied housing accounts for 73.62% of Ruffin's homes, and 70.08% have either three or four bedrooms, which is average sized relative to America.
Ruffin homes and real estate are some of the newest in America. 41.67% of Ruffin's housing was built since 2000, making the town have a very new look and feel. If you like the amenities of newer homes and subdivisions, then you will probably like what the Ruffin real estate market has to offer. Quite a bit of the housing here was also built between 1970-1999 ( 31.06%), and before 1939 ( 15.53%). There's also some housing in Ruffin built between 1940-1969 ( 11.74%).
Vacant housing appears to be an issue in Ruffin. Fully 10.98% of the housing stock is classified as vacant. Left unchecked, vacant Ruffin homes and apartments can be a drag on the real estate market, holding Ruffin real estate prices below levels they could achieve if vacant housing was absorbed into the market and became occupied. Housing vacancy rates are a useful measure to consider, along with other things, if you are a home buyer or a real estate investor.
Appreciation rates for homes in Ruffin have been tracking above average for the last ten years, according to NeighborhoodScout data. The cumulative appreciation rate over the ten years has been 93.25%, which ranks in the top 50% nationwide. This equates to an annual average Ruffin house appreciation rate of 6.81%.
Over the last year, Ruffin appreciation rates have trailed the rest of the nation. In the last twelve months, Ruffin's appreciation rate has been 0.96%, which is lower than appreciation rates in most communities in America. In the latest quarter, NeighborhoodScout's data show that house appreciation rates in Ruffin were at -0.22%, which equates to an annual appreciation rate of -0.87%.
Notably, Ruffin's appreciation rate in the latest quarter is one of the lowest in America.
Relative to North Carolina, our data show that Ruffin's latest annual appreciation rate is lower than 60% of the other cities and towns in North Carolina.
